**Job Purpose**:
Responsible for managing IO’s Lifecycle Asset Management Planning (LAMP) business offering to client ministries, agencies and broader public sector.

Establish synergies and lead process improvement initiatives and ensure the continuous improvement of the LAMP initiative.

Lead and support a team of LAMP advisors by providing oversight to manage service providers in the collection of condition, functional and utilization metrics.
